Cadmium is a soft, bluish-white transition metal with unique protective properties. Zyntex supplies high-purity Cadmium (CAS 7440-43-9) in various forms like balls, anodes, and ingots for global industry. This metal provides a superior sacrificial coating for steel and iron. It prevents rust even in harsh salt-water environments. In addition, it possesses a low coefficient of friction and excellent electrical conductivity. Therefore, engineers specify it for aerospace fasteners, heavy-duty electrical connectors, and specialized anti-friction alloys.

Outstanding corrosion protection provides a major advantage in the defense and aerospace sectors. Cadmium electroplating acts as a reliable barrier against environmental degradation. It does not produce bulky corrosion products that could jam moving parts. For instance, it is the standard coating for aircraft bolts and landing gear components. Consequently, it ensures the structural integrity of critical flight hardware. As a result, Zyntex provides high-grade Cadmium anodes that ensure uniform plating thickness and high bath efficiency.

Moreover, Zyntex supplies Cadmium for the production of low-melting-point alloys and solders. These alloys are vital for safety devices like fire sprinklers and thermal fuses. It pushes the boundaries of precision thermal engineering. At the same time, its high neutron-absorption cross-section makes it essential for nuclear energy. It effectively controls the rate of nuclear fission in reactor rods. Key Industrial Applications

This versatile transition metal is vital in these four sectors:

✈️ Aerospace Plating

The gold standard for protecting fasteners and connectors from salt spray. Thus, it prevents hydrogen embrittlement in high-strength steels.

🔋 Battery Alloys

Used in specialized alkaline battery systems. Consequently, it supports long-lasting energy storage for industrial emergency power.

⚛️ Nuclear Engineering

Acts as an efficient neutron absorber in reactor control rods. Undoubtedly, it is critical for the safe operation of nuclear power plants.

🛠️ Fusible Alloys

Essential for creating metals that melt at very specific low temperatures. Specifically, it is a key component in automatic fire suppressors.

⚠️ Health & Environmental Safety: Cadmium is a toxic heavy metal and is strictly regulated. Therefore, handle only with proper safety equipment and avoid creating metal dust or fumes. Always ensure that plating baths and metal waste are treated according to environmental laws to prevent water and soil contamination.
